I use my hand and feel the slicks from the inside to the outside and use the air pressor to get a uniform feel on the slicks, radial or bias ply.
On the bias ply slicks if you feel the outer and inner edges and they are rough and same roughness in the middle that tire needs more air in them to get the same feel, texture all the way across.
If most of the tire is rough but the edges are smooth let some air out, I use 1/2 Lb. increments to get me in the ballpark and fine tune from their in 1/4 lb. increments, I try and use as much pressure in them that I can as long as they don't spin
